It was a Halloween party and DD2 put on a long, dark, black wig. It looked awesome but what was more striking was the effect it had on noticing the colour of her eyes. Literally reframing her face with different hair style had encouraged me to notice things about her face that I had always know were there and never noticed.




    When I work with couples one of the gripes is 'boredom'. The sameness of today to yesterday. It occurs in every relationship - familial, friend, work, Dr/patient - anyone you meet regularly.So here's an idea. Each time you meet them consciously look for one new thing, or thing you'd forgotten about them. Make the effort to see the new to you.It's not a requirement to tell them - although I did tell DD2 how pretty her eyes looked. It's about seeing with a present mind.
